Improving Lithium Ion Battery Life

Improving Lithium Ion Battery Life

Researchers at Stanford University in Palo Alto, California are developing new carbon-silicon nanowire electrodes that increase the charge storage capacity of current lithium ion batteries by as much as 600 percent. Unlike recent electrodes using pure silicon, the carbon-silicon nanowires ...

Sci-Fi Future: Battery Viruses

Sci-Fi Future: Battery Viruses

Engineers at Massachusetts Institute of Technology (MIT) have developed a method to create and install tiny microbatteries which are the size of half a human cell. Using viruses to generate power, this new type of battery could one day power ...

Last Retinal Movement-Detecting Cell Discovered

Last Retinal Movement-Detecting Cell Discovered

In collaboration between high-energy physicists from the University of California in Santa Cruz, and neuroscientists from the Salk Institute in La Jolla, California, a ganglion cell in the retina of primates was found to react to movement. The cell was ...
